MeXicana Fashions: Politics, Self-Adornment, and Identity Construction
Aida Hurtado-Norma E. Cantu
Fifteen scholars examine the social identities, class hierarchies, regionalisms, and other codes of communication that are exhibited or perceived in meXicana clothing styles.
